Media Buyer Broadcast salary in Italy

Average Yearly Salary of Media Buyer Broadcast in Italy is approximately 39,671 EUR (39,675 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Media Buyer Broadcast do?

occupation personasA media buyer in the broadcast industry is responsible for planning, negotiating, and purchasing advertising space or airtime on various broadcast platforms such as television, radio, and digital channels. They work closely with clients and advertising agencies to understand their marketing objectives and target audience, and develop effective media strategies to reach those goals. The media buyer conducts market research, analyzes audience demographics, and identifies the most suitable media outlets to maximize the impact of the advertising campaign. They negotiate pricing and contracts with media vendors, ensuring the best possible rates and placements for their clients. Additionally, media buyers monitor and evaluate the performance of campaigns, making adjustments as needed to optimize results. This occupation requires strong analytical skills, negotiation abilities, and knowledge of media trends and consumer behavior.
